Irish TV personality Vogue Williams has claimed her husband Spencer Matthews is refusing to be intimate with her during the final stage of her pregnancy.

The 40-year-old broadcaster is expecting her fourth child, a baby boy, with the former Made In Chelsea reality star in October.

Speaking on the latest episode of her podcast, My Therapist Ghosted Me, Williams told co-host Joanne McNally that she believed her husband no longer found her attractive as her due date neared.

"I'm trying to look good looking today because I don’t think Spenny fancies me anymore," Williams said during the broadcast.

McNally joked in response: "Of course he doesn’t! You have been married for ages now, come on."

Williams laughed off the comment before explaining that their physical intimacy had halted. "No, because I think our fun times are over if you get me," she said. "I’m too pregnant now. I don’t want to. I was just being a nice wife and a good participant."

The podcast admission comes shortly after Williams officially revealed the gender of their upcoming baby on her YouTube channel on Monday. The couple, who married in 2018, confirmed they are expecting another boy.

Williams and Matthews are already parents to sons Theodore, seven, and Otto, three, as well as five-year-old daughter Gigi.

In the video recorded in their car, Williams asked her husband: "Will we say what we’re having?" Matthews replied: "We know, obviously. Have you not told people?" Williams admitted: "I don’t know. I just got a feeling there."

The couple then turned the camera to children Gigi and Theodore in the back seat, asking them to announce the baby's sex. Gigi shouted, "A boy!" prompting Williams to confirm: "We’re having another boy." Matthews added: "We’re owed a nice, sensitive soul."

With the baby due in just a few weeks, Williams revealed that she and Matthews are struggling to settle on a name and have asked their fans to send in suggestions.
